For creating PDFs, a lot of software now includes this functionality. Open Office makes particularly clean, compact and compatible PDFs.

But Win 10 seems to now come with a PDF printer that is one of the printers that shows up when you open the print dialogue. It seems to work OK too, I've been using it to generate PDF copies of schematics from an early version of Protel I'm using while in lockdown at home..
